The Arts Connected with Architecture illustrated by examples in Central Italy from the 13th to the 15th Century.

London: Vincent Brooks, 1858. Binding: contemporary ½ morocco with cloth boards, expertly rebacked. Spine with 6 compartments of raised bands gilt lettering on two., Notes: “John Burley Waring entered the Royal Academy, in 1843-44 found him in Italy where he studied painting …Waring not only drew and painted, but he wrote extensively about art, architecture, and architectural sculpture, among other subjects.” (Cornell University Library), Size: Folio, Illustration: Elegant frontis dedication page in cursive text. Chromolithgraphed title page and 41 chromolithographed plates by Vincent Brooks depicting various Italian stained glass scenes and frescos., Pages: P. frontis, blank, title, blank, iii-iv, (1), blank, 1-29, Category: Book Europe Italy; Book Art, Architecture & Design;. The margins of the title page and some leaves are reinforced otherwise a very good copy, text is clean and plates are fresh. Item #B2329
